Description

Description

The four Letters to a German friend, written during the Occupation and intended for clandestine publications, already express the doctrine of The Plague and The Rebel.

They invoke Senancour who, in a striking formula, had summarized the philosophy of revolt: Man is perishable. It may be; but let us perish in resistance, and if nothingness is reserved for us, let it not be justice!
